Alex de Minaur advanced to his third ATP Tour semifinal of 2019 with a three-set win over Borna Coric on Friday night in Zhuhai.

The Australian, seeded seventh, upstaged the No.4 seed 6-2 4-6 6-4 in a physically punishing match featuring several thrilling baseline rallies.

De Minaur, the champion in Sydney and Atlanta this season, will face world No.10 Roberto Bautista Agut for a place in the final.

De Minaur was exceptional in the opening set, beating Coric in just about every facet in the game — consistency, speed, power and depth.

The young Aussie broke the world No.14 immediately to open the second set and had three break points for a 3-0 lead.

Despite not converting those and dropping serve in the next game, De Minaur broke Coric again in the seventh game — only for Coric to break straight back.

That formed part of a four-game run for Coric, but once De Minaur held in the second game of the third set, his frustration seemed to dissipate and his focus returned.

He broke Coric in the following game and never looked back, maintaining his advantage to run out a winner in two hours and 18 minutes.
